Commit Graph

133 Commits

Author SHA1 Message Date
Sarina Canelake
e0dbb0758c Update translations (autogenerated message) 2015-06-12 14:56:59 -04:00
Sarina Canelake
c64567045a Update translations (autogenerated message) 2015-06-05 13:52:52 -04:00
Sarina Canelake
fe789d6c43 Update translations (autogenerated message) 2015-05-29 15:26:13 -04:00
Sarina Canelake
e72d5d542b Add fake Arabic testing language 2015-05-29 10:16:30 -04:00
Will Daly
6af5fc1452 ECOM-1339 Branding API footer
Serve branded footer JSON/HTML/CSS/JS from an API endpoint
in the branding app.  Refactor OpenEdX and EdX.org footer templates
to use the Python version of the API, ensuring that the API
values are consistent with the footer included in main.html.

Detailed changes:

* Added footer API end-point to the branding app.
* Footer API allows the language to be set with querystring parameters.
* Footer API allows showing/hiding of the OpenEdX logo using querystring parameters.
* Deprecate ENABLE_FOOTER_V3 in favor of the branding API configuration flag.
* Move no referrer script into main.html from the edx footer template.
* Rename rwd_header_footer.js to rwd_header.js
* Cache API responses.

Authors:
Awais Qureshi, Aamir Khan, Will Daly
2015-05-28 08:30:45 -04:00
Sarina Canelake
b91bc1a201 Update translations (autogenerated message) 2015-05-26 11:48:51 -04:00
Sarina Canelake
87954cd1e0 Update translations (autogenerated message) 2015-05-15 13:20:53 -04:00
Sarina Canelake
e784a43487 Update translations (autogenerated message) 2015-05-08 13:57:58 -04:00
Sarina Canelake
78684903f6 Update translations (autogenerated message) 2015-04-30 11:58:39 -04:00
Sarina Canelake
1504abe292 Only pull languages we want from Transifex 2015-04-24 15:15:17 -04:00
Sarina Canelake
da036307a0 Update translations (autogenerated message) 2015-04-24 15:15:16 -04:00
Sarina Canelake
9bdb820fa7 Update translations (autogenerated message) 2015-04-21 10:07:28 -04:00
Chris Rossi
3256eb1ff6 Architecture for arbitrary field overrides, field overrides for
individual students, and a reimplementation of the individual due date
feature.

This work introduces an architecture, used with the 'authored_data'
portion of LmsFieldData, which allows arbitrary field overrides to be
made for fields that are part of the course content or settings (Mongo
data).  The basic architecture is extensible by means of writing and
configuring arbitrary field override providers.

One concrete implementation of a field override provider is provided
which allows for overrides to be for individual students.  This provider
is then used as a basis for reimplementing the individual due date
extensions feature as a proof of concept for the design.

One can imagine writing override providers that provide overrides based
on a student's membership in a cohort or other similar idea.  This work
is being done, in fact, to pave the way for the Personal Online Courses
feature being developed by MIT, which will use an override provider very
much long those lines.
2015-04-06 13:04:44 -07:00
Sarina Canelake
4dea3aa9df Update translations (autogenerated message) 2015-04-06 09:26:06 -04:00
Sarina Canelake
5a04a38106 Update translations (autogenerated message) 2015-03-30 09:09:31 -04:00
Sarina Canelake
71486fc45b Update translations (autogenerated message) 2015-03-23 10:49:44 -04:00
Sarina Canelake
3569e7fef5 Update translations (autogenerated message) 2015-03-16 10:32:27 -04:00
Sarina Canelake
6ccc553fcb Update translations (autogenerated message) 2015-03-02 15:06:43 -05:00
Sarina Canelake
40745c2899 Update translations (autogenerated message) 2015-02-23 13:53:13 -05:00
Sarina Canelake
f6e8867457 Update translations (autogenerated message) 2015-02-17 11:54:13 -05:00
Sarina Canelake
bbbb630e08 Update translations (autogenerated message) 2015-02-11 10:53:17 -05:00
Sarina Canelake
67fbfdc8e0 Update translations (autogenerated message) 2015-02-02 09:12:54 -05:00
Sarina Canelake
78c5bddd43 Update translations (autogenerated message) 2015-01-26 09:10:25 -05:00
Sarina Canelake
503f4d95bb Update translations (autogenerated message) 2015-01-20 10:04:06 -05:00
Sarina Canelake
55d85ad643 Update translations (autogenerated message) 2015-01-12 10:48:58 -05:00
Sarina Canelake
41c5c3a949 Update translations (autogenerated message) 2015-01-05 10:18:59 -05:00
Sarina Canelake
f70e531df9 Update translations (autogenerated message) 2014-12-15 12:40:36 -08:00
Sarina Canelake
dc6926bb2d Update translations (autogenerated message) 2014-12-08 08:56:07 -05:00
Sarina Canelake
767799c9be Update translations (autogenerated message) 2014-12-01 11:53:35 -05:00
Sarina Canelake
371805a8c3 Update translations (autogenerated message) 2014-11-10 10:52:34 -05:00
Sarina Canelake
67ebd5ecd8 Update translations '
(autogenerated message)
2014-11-03 14:21:41 -05:00
Sarina Canelake
e4bfa0f9ff Update translations (autogenerated message) 2014-10-27 11:43:16 -04:00
Will Daly
5a9da83abf Update translation strings to ensure tests pass 2014-10-20 12:39:20 -04:00
Sarina Canelake
93cfdc86d4 Update translations (autogenerated message) 2014-10-20 10:59:51 -04:00
Frances Botsford
e255ac1f29 Initial pass at LMS and Studio RTL 2014-10-17 13:51:42 -04:00
Sarina Canelake
724f7ac8ec Update translations (autogenerated message) 2014-10-14 12:50:44 -04:00
Renzo Lucioni
00d976b85d Use Backbone for student account and profile JS.
Validate student account and profile form fields. Use RequireJS for Jasmine tests of account and profile JS.
2014-10-08 15:50:13 -04:00
Andy Armstrong
191aba967b Translate strings in LMS Underscore templates 2014-10-01 12:12:50 -04:00
Sarina Canelake
5cdd4f4c80 Update translations (autogenerated message) 2014-09-24 14:19:21 -04:00
Sarina Canelake
701d709b65 Update translations (autogenerated message) 2014-09-23 15:41:41 -04:00
Renzo Lucioni
c78594b286 Restore copy originally present on the registration page 2014-09-17 16:53:25 -04:00
Renzo Lucioni
66187ab907 Clean up translated strings in registration page, dashboard, and track selection flow 2014-09-17 14:38:24 -04:00
Sarina Canelake
b618516dc1 Update translations (autogenerated message) 2014-09-16 10:54:09 -04:00
Sarina Canelake
ba500b5e70 Update translations (autogenerated message) 2014-09-15 10:02:39 -04:00
Sarina Canelake
f0c8139ad8 Transifex config: add Swedish and Swahili language codes 2014-09-10 11:48:45 -04:00
Sarina Canelake
a37ec7a10f Update translations (autogenerated message) 2014-09-08 11:14:47 -04:00
Sarina Canelake
c11764e9b9 Update translations (autogenerated message) 2014-08-22 12:14:58 -04:00
Sarina Canelake
b6102462ac Update translations (autogenerated message) 2014-08-04 11:31:40 -04:00
Sarina Canelake
ecba41e865 Add Eng (GB) and Albanian lang codes 2014-08-04 11:13:06 -04:00
Sarina Canelake
79d3f798f3 Update translations (autogenerated message) 2014-07-28 10:29:32 -04:00